NEWS
Loop über Verzeichnisse in Objekte
-
Wie kann ich mittels Blockly oder JavaScript über "Verzeichnisse" bei den Objekten loopen? [gelöst]
Hintergrund: Seriennummer vom aktuellen Echo-Device ist bekannt, nun soll automatisch die richtige Stelle aus den Objekten herausgesucht werden (hier sind da alle aufgeführt), damit eine Antwort generiert werden kann.
Mit statischen IF-Abfragen bekomme ich das hin, allerdings muss jedes Device extra aufgeführt werden, daher hätte ich den Teil gern dynamisch.
@liv-in-sky
Danke, genau das hatte ich gesucht -
@rene-isserstedt
z.b.
über einen selektor$('unifi.0.*.clients.*.mac').each(function(id, i) { // hier eigene schleife definieren var ida = id.split('.'); valESSID="" .........
blockly:
so geht man durch die gesuchten dp - in der schleife erstellst du ein array der id und kannst somit auf etwas bestimmtes in der id suchen
beispiel:
alexa2.0.Echo-Devices.G001xxxxxx530JR4.Commands.speakvar ida = id.split('.');
dann wäre ida[3] die seriennummer (G001xxxxxx530JR4)